Shift Pattern: Monday to Thursday 6am - 2:30pm and Friday 6am - 12:00 midday.
Key responsibilities will include but are not limited to:
- To work within a team to maintain the soft landscape to a high standard in a theme park environment.
- Carry out garden maintenance including mowing, strimming, weeding, pruning and hedge cutting in guest facing areas.
- To carry out planting including seasonal bedding and lawn care to the highest standards.
- To work with and maintain a large range of landscaping machinery including tractors and implements as well as ride on mowers.
- Working in a safe manner at all times, complying with work based risk assessments and COSHH regulations that supports a safety-first culture within the team.
- Maintaining ride area safety, ensuring ride area clearances are maintained and identifying and reporting tree works when required.
Key hiring criteria:
- Applicant must have the right to work in the UK.
- A level 2 NVQ in amenity horticulture (or equivalent).
- Proven 5 years of commercial gardening or horticulture experience.
- NPTC PA1 and PA6 qualification in application of pesticides.
- Any NPTC qualifications in use of chainsaw beneficial but not essential.
- This is a hands-on physical role and be able to carry out all gardening tasks as well as work in all weathers.
